Federal and State Regulations for Drinking Water

In order to keep your thirst-quenching experience as risk-free as possible, both the federal government and the state of New York have put water safety regulations in place. These standards cover everything from the detection and removal of potential contaminants to routine testing and monitoring. Cheers to that!

The federal regulations, set forth by the Environmental Protection Agency (EPA), establish the minimum requirements for water quality and safety. These regulations are enforced by the state of New York, which has its own set of additional standards to ensure that Salisbury's water meets or exceeds the federal requirements.

Under these regulations, Salisbury's water treatment facilities are required to regularly test the water for a wide range of contaminants, including bacteria, viruses, chemicals, and heavy metals. The water is also tested for pH levels and chlorine content to ensure that it meets the appropriate standards for taste and odor.

How Water Quality is Measured

But how do they determine whether Salisbury's water is pure enough for your delicate taste buds? Water quality is measured through a combination of laboratory tests, including checking its pH levels, chlorine content, and the presence of any unwanted hitchhikers (like bacteria or heavy metals). It's like giving your water a full medical checkup!

When it comes to measuring water quality, accuracy is of utmost importance. Salisbury's water treatment facilities employ highly trained professionals who follow strict protocols to collect and analyze water samples. These samples are then tested in state-certified laboratories using advanced equipment and techniques.

The pH level of the water is an important indicator of its acidity or alkalinity. Salisbury's water treatment facilities carefully monitor and adjust the pH levels to ensure that the water is within the acceptable range for drinking. Similarly, chlorine is added to the water as a disinfectant to kill any harmful bacteria or viruses that may be present.

In addition to pH levels and chlorine content, the water is also tested for the presence of any unwanted hitchhikers. Bacteria, such as E. coli, and heavy metals, such as lead or mercury, can pose serious health risks if present in the water. Salisbury's water treatment facilities conduct regular tests to detect and remove these contaminants, ensuring that the water you drink is safe and free from any harmful substances.
